THE PREMIER.
(Pen Press Association.) Oamaru, yesterday. The Premier left for tbo North to-day. Replying to a deputation interested in dairying, in regard to cheaper freights, he stated that tho Government fully recognised the necessity, and were determined that freights Bhould be more in line with those in Australia The question was under consideration, also tho question of further facilities for shipping to the West of England ports.
